Arden House
10/10 Excellent
"This was our first time visiting Arden House and we are so glad we went. Lucie was a fantastic host and gave us a lovely welcome. We stayed at room 3 on the ground at the back of the property, and the room was brilliant. It was immaculately clean, bright and airy with two lovely big bay windows. It had a great en-suite toilet, basin and shower with towels, complimentary shower gel, slippers and dressing gown. There was tea and coffee making facilities/kettle cups etc. and two bottles of water and glasses which was a real bonus during the night. The entire house was really lovely and big, as was the dining room. Breakfast was a huge spread of a number of different fruit, cereals, nuts, yoghurts, oats, homemade cake, orange and cranberry juice, James, peanut butter, marmite, babybel cheeses and Luice made us a boiled egg and toast, with freshly made cafetiere coffee and tea to drink. Free off road parking, free wi-fi, a TV (which we didn't need as we were out so much), a large electric fan in the room and a hairdryer, two chairs and foot rest. We highly recommend this B&B for a great stay, so close to the centre of town and the castle. Brilliant value for money and we would definitely go back again. Thank you Lucie, I'm sure we will be back again"
